Synopsis
Shakespeare's seasonal comedy about a shipwreck that separates identical twins Sebastian and Viola. Fearing for her safety, Viola disguises herself as her brother.

The BBC Television Shakespeare | Twelfth Night, Or What You Will
A 1980 BBC production of Shakespeare's comedy play. This was broadcast as part of the 37-play BBC Television Shakespeare project.
